About this Exam

The Certified Education Technology Leader (CETL) certification is the premier credential for professionals who lead, manage, and influence technology decisions in K-12 education. It is designed for Chief Technology Officers (CTOs), technology directors, and other leaders who define the vision for technology integration in schools. This rigorous certification, administered by the Consortium for School Networking (CoSN), bridges the gap between an instructional focus and technical infrastructure management. By achieving the CETL designation, leaders demonstrate their mastery of the framework skills and knowledge needed to drive digital transformation, improve learning outcomes, and manage school system technology effectively. What the Course Entails and Exam Details

The CETL certification process is not a course but an assessment of experience and knowledge based on CoSN's comprehensive "Framework of Essential Skills of the K-12 CTO." However, many candidates find value in official prep courses, and a "CETL Practice Exam" is a crucial component of study. The core content is organized into three major skill areas, further divided into 10 essential domains:

  • Core Area 1: Leadership & Vision
  • Domain 1: Strategic Planning
  • Domain 2: Ethics & Policies
  • Domain 3: Political Leadership & Action
  • Core Area 2: Understanding the Educational Environment
  • Domain 4: Instructional Focus & Professional Development
  • Domain 5: Team Building & Staffing
  • Domain 6: Understanding the K-12 Educational System
  • Core Area 3: Managing Technology & Support Resources
  • Domain 7: Information Technology Management
  • Domain 8: Communication Systems Management
  • Domain 9: Business Management
  • Domain 10: Data Management & Security

The "course" for you entails deeply studying these areas. You will need to understand and apply best practices, state and federal laws, pedagogical strategies that leverage technology, data privacy standards, and the principles of both total cost of ownership (TCO) and value of investment (VOI) in educational technology.

What to Expect in the Final Exam

The final CETL exam is a true measure of today's education technology leader. It is a two-part assessment, and candidates must pass Part I to progress to Part II. Only by successfully completing both can you earn the CETL designation.

Part I: Multiple-Choice Exam

  • Format: Computer-based, multiple-choice questions.
  • Content: 100 scored questions covering all 10 domains of the CoSN Framework.
  • Time Limit: You will typically be given a defined period, such as two hours, to complete this section.
  • Passing Score: Results are reported as a scaled score ranging from 0 to 800. A scaled score of 600 or higher is required to pass.

Part II: Essay-Based Exam

  • Format: Essay questions that require applying knowledge to real-world scenarios.
  • Content: This section focuses on your ability to effectively communicate highly technical concepts to a broad stakeholder base and make strategic leadership decisions.
  • Time Limit: Usually a separate session with its own time allocation.
  • Grading: Graded by a panel of experts trained using a pre-determined rubric.

Candidates are allowed to retake parts of the exam if they fail, subject to retake fees and waiting periods defined by CoSN.

 

 

 How to Study and Exam Centers

To succeed on the CETL, you must combine theoretical knowledge with your professional experience. Here are actionable study strategies:

  • Master the CoSN Framework: This is your primary study guide. Review every domain and self-assess your proficiency.
  • Use the Official CETL Practice Exam: This is a vital resource. A practice exam helps you understand the question format, identify weak areas, and manage your time.
  • Engage in CoSN Resources: Utilize CoSN’s 11-module training guide, online self-assessment tools, and webinars. Join a CoSN-facilitated virtual course or a local study group to collaborate with peers.
  • Connect with a Mentor: Seek guidance from current CETL-certified professionals who can share their insights and test-day experiences.

Exam Centers and Testing Methods: The CETL exam is accessible worldwide.

  • Pearson VUE: The exam is administered at Pearson VUE testing centers, offering a secure, proctored environment.
  • Remote Proctoring: CoSN also provides a remote proctoring option, allowing you to take the exam from the comfort of your own home or office, as long as it meets specific security and technical requirements.
  • Authorization to Test: You must first apply and be approved by CoSN. Upon approval, you will receive an "Authorization to Test" email with your Eligibility ID to schedule your appointment at a location or method of your choice.

 

 

 Job Opportunities from the Course

Earning the CETL designation provides immediate recognition of your leadership and opens doors to cabinet-level roles and increased responsibility. This certification unlocks a clear path for professional growth and significant job opportunities, including:

  • Chief Technology Officer (CTO)
  • Chief Information Officer (CIO) for a School District
  • Director of Technology
  • Executive Director of Technology
  • Technology Coordinator
  • Instructional Technology Director
  • Educational Technology Consultant
  • State-Level EdTech Leader
  • College or University EdTech Director
  • IT Director for Education Non-Profit Organizations
